-/**
- * @file
- * $Author$
- * $Revision$
- * $Date$
- *
- * Low level interface to SPI/eSE driver.
- *
- */
-
-#include <string.h>
-#include <errno.h>
-#include <unistd.h>
-#include <sys/types.h>
-#include <fcntl.h>
-#include <sys/ioctl.h>
-#include <linux/se_gemalto.h>
-
-#include "libse-gto-private.h"
-#include "spi.h"
-
-#define USE_OPEN_RETRY
-#define MAX_RETRY_CNT 10
-
-int
-spi_setup(struct se_gto_ctx *ctx)
-{
-#ifdef USE_OPEN_RETRY
- int retryCnt = 0;
-
-retry:
- ctx->t1.spi_fd = open(ctx->gtodev, O_RDWR);
- if (ctx->t1.spi_fd < 0) {
- err("cannot use %s for spi device, errno = 0x%x\n", ctx->gtodev, errno);
- if(errno == -EBUSY || errno == EBUSY) {
- retryCnt++;
- err("Retry open driver - retry cnt : %d\n", retryCnt);
- if(retryCnt < MAX_RETRY_CNT) {
- sleep(1);
- goto retry;
- }
- }
- return -1;
- }
-#else
- ctx->t1.spi_fd = open(ctx->gtodev, O_RDWR);
- if (ctx->t1.spi_fd < 0) {
- err("cannot use %s for spi device\n", ctx->gtodev);
- return -1;
- }
-#endif
- return ctx->t1.spi_fd < 0;
-}
-
-int
-spi_teardown(struct se_gto_ctx *ctx)
-{
- if (ctx->t1.spi_fd >= 0)
- if (close(ctx->t1.spi_fd) < 0)
- warn("failed to close fd to %s, %s.\n", ctx->gtodev, strerror(errno));
- ctx->t1.spi_fd = -1;
- return 0;
-}
-
-int
-spi_write(int fd, const void *buf, size_t count)
-{
- ssize_t n;
-
- n = write(fd, buf, count);
- if ((int)n != n)
- return -EFAULT;
-
- return (int)n;
-}
-
-int
-spi_read(int fd, void *buf, size_t count)
-{
- ssize_t n;
-
- n = read(fd, buf, count);
- if ((int)n != n)
- return -EFAULT;
-
- return (int)n;
-}
